It lets you create a beautiful responsive Testimonial Slideshow. == Description == Using this plugin you can add a interactive Testimonial slider to any page or post. This plugin offer a shortcode to create Slideshow. It is fully responsive and looks good in any device. This plugin using a jquery plugin [Owl Carousel](http://www.owlcarousel.owlgraphic.com/) by Owlgraphic. = Shortcode Example = ` [tss_testimonial_slider align="center" padding="0 40px" loop="1" autoplay="1" dots="1" nav="1" class=""] [tss_item text="Abelson has been an amazing firm to work with. Lorem changed the company." name="— JOHN SAMPSON, LEONARD GREEN & PARTNERS, LP" link=""/] [/tss_testimonial_slider] ` = So what are the arguments of the main shortcode? = **align** you can sent the slider alignment here, support values are `left`, `right` or `center` **padding** Possible value is pure CSS. Example `0 40px` **loop** Enable or disable loop by adding `0` or `1` **autoplay** Enable or disable autoplay by adding `0` or `1` **dots** Enable or disable dot nav by adding `0` or `1` **nav** Enable or disable left right arrow nav by adding `0` or `1` = So what are the arguments of the Sub shortcode? = **text** this is the text of the slider item **name** name of the testimonial author **link** full link == Installation == 1. Upload `testimonial-slider-shortcode` to the `/wp-content/plugins/` directory 1. Activate the plugin through the 'Plugins' menu in WordPress == Frequently Asked Questions == = What is the Shortcode? = Below is the example of the shoercode. ` [tss_testimonial_slider align="center" padding="0 40px" loop="1" autoplay="1" dots="1" nav="1" class=""] [tss_item text="Abelson has been an amazing firm to work with.
